| package org.eclipse.core.internal.preferences; |
| |
| import java.util.Hashtable; |
| import org.eclipse.core.internal.runtime.RuntimeLog; |
| import org.eclipse.core.runtime.IStatus; |
| import org.eclipse.core.runtime.Status; |
| import org.eclipse.core.runtime.preferences.IPreferencesService; |
| import org.eclipse.osgi.service.environment.EnvironmentInfo; |
| import org.osgi.framework.*; |
| import org.osgi.util.tracker.ServiceTracker; |
| import org.osgi.util.tracker.ServiceTrackerCustomizer; |
| |
| /** |
| * The Preferences bundle activator. |
| */ |
| public class Activator implements BundleActivator, ServiceTrackerCustomizer<Object, Object> { |
| |
| public static final String PI_PREFERENCES = "org.eclipse.equinox.preferences"; //$NON-NLS-1$ |
| |
| /** |
| * Eclipse property. Set to <code>false</code> to avoid registering JobManager |
| * as an OSGi service. |
| */ |
| private static final String PROP_REGISTER_PERF_SERVICE = "eclipse.service.pref"; //$NON-NLS-1$ |
| // the system property |
| private static final String PROP_CUSTOMIZATION = "eclipse.pluginCustomization"; //$NON-NLS-1$ |
| |
| /** |
| * Track the registry service - only register preference service if the registry is |
| * available |
| */ |
| private ServiceTracker<?, ?> registryServiceTracker; |
| |
| /** |
| * The bundle associated this plug-in |
| */ |
| private static BundleContext bundleContext; |
| |
| /** |
| * This plugin provides a Preferences service. |
| */ |
| private ServiceRegistration<IPreferencesService> preferencesService; |
| |
| /** |
| * This plugin provides the OSGi Preferences service. |
| */ |
| private ServiceRegistration<org.osgi.service.prefs.PreferencesService> osgiPreferencesService; |
| |
| |
| @Override |
| public void start(BundleContext context) throws Exception { |
| bundleContext = context; |
| // Open the services first before processing the command-line args, order is important! (Bug 150288) |
| PreferencesOSGiUtils.getDefault().openServices(); |
| processCommandLine(); |
| |
| boolean shouldRegister = !"false".equalsIgnoreCase(context.getProperty(PROP_REGISTER_PERF_SERVICE)); //$NON-NLS-1$ |
| if (shouldRegister) { |
| preferencesService = bundleContext.registerService(IPreferencesService.class, PreferencesService.getDefault(), new Hashtable<String, Object>()); |
| osgiPreferencesService = bundleContext.registerService(org.osgi.service.prefs.PreferencesService.class, new OSGiPreferencesServiceManager(bundleContext), null); |
| } |
| // use the string for the class name here in case the registry isn't around |
| registryServiceTracker = new ServiceTracker<>(bundleContext, "org.eclipse.core.runtime.IExtensionRegistry", this); //$NON-NLS-1$ |
| registryServiceTracker.open(); |
| } |
| |
| |
| @Override |
| public void stop(BundleContext context) throws Exception { |
| PreferencesOSGiUtils.getDefault().closeServices(); |
| if (registryServiceTracker != null) { |
| registryServiceTracker.close(); |
| registryServiceTracker = null; |
| } |
| if (preferencesService != null) { |
| preferencesService.unregister(); |
| preferencesService = null; |
| } |
| if (osgiPreferencesService != null) { |
| osgiPreferencesService.unregister(); |
| osgiPreferencesService = null; |
| } |
| bundleContext = null; |
| } |
| |
| static BundleContext getContext() { |
| return bundleContext; |
| } |
| |
| |
| @Override |
| public synchronized Object addingService(ServiceReference<Object> reference) { |
| Object service = bundleContext.getService(reference); |
| // this check is important as it avoids early loading of PreferenceServiceRegistryHelper and allows |
| // this bundle to operate with out necessarily resolving against the registry |
| if (service != null) { |
| try { |
| Object helper = new PreferenceServiceRegistryHelper(PreferencesService.getDefault(), service); |
| PreferencesService.getDefault().setRegistryHelper(helper); |
| } catch (Exception e) { |
| RuntimeLog.log(new Status(IStatus.ERROR, PI_PREFERENCES, 0, PrefsMessages.noRegistry, e)); |
| } catch (NoClassDefFoundError error) { |
| // Normally this catch would not be needed since we should never see the |
| // IExtensionRegistry service without resolving against registry. |
| // However, the check is very lenient with split packages and this can happen when |
| // the preferences bundle is already resolved at the time the registry bundle is installed. |
| // For this case we ignore the error. When refreshed the bundle will be rewired correctly. |
| // null is returned because we don't want to track this particular service reference. |
| return null; |
| } |
| } |
| //return the registry service so we track it |
| return service; |
| } |
| |
| |
| @Override |
| public void modifiedService(ServiceReference<Object> reference, Object service) { |
| // nothing to do |
| } |
| |
| |
| @Override |
| public synchronized void removedService(ServiceReference<Object> reference, Object service) { |
| PreferencesService.getDefault().setRegistryHelper(null); |
| bundleContext.ungetService(reference); |
| } |
| |
| /** |
| * Look for the plug-in customization file in the system properties and command-line args. |
| */ |
| private void processCommandLine() { |
| // check the value of the system property first because its quicker. |
| // if it exists, then set it otherwise look at the command-line arguments. |
| String value = bundleContext.getProperty(PROP_CUSTOMIZATION); |
| if (value != null) { |
| DefaultPreferences.pluginCustomizationFile = value; |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| ServiceTracker<?, EnvironmentInfo> environmentTracker = new ServiceTracker<>(bundleContext, EnvironmentInfo.class, null); |
| environmentTracker.open(); |
| EnvironmentInfo environmentInfo = environmentTracker.getService(); |
| environmentTracker.close(); |
| if (environmentInfo == null) |
| return; |
| String[] args = environmentInfo.getNonFrameworkArgs(); |
| if (args == null || args.length == 0) |
| return; |
| |
| for (int i = 0; i < args.length; i++) { |
| if (args[i].equalsIgnoreCase(IPreferencesConstants.PLUGIN_CUSTOMIZATION)) { |
| if (args.length > i + 1) // make sure the file name is actually there |
| DefaultPreferences.pluginCustomizationFile = args[i + 1]; |
| break; // only interested in this one |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| } |
